Absenteeism, ineffectiveness, stress, and overwhelm can occur when leaders and managers are asked to deliver more with less.
When under pressure people struggle to maintain their composure, effectiveness, and emotional well-being.
Resilience is about having the tools and knowledge to successfully navigate challenging and stressful times.
